Abstract

The present Regulations are made under the Farm Financial Stability Act. In particular, the Regulations establish the 2011 Saskatchewan Feed and Forage Programme. The purpose of the programme is to provide financial assistance, inter alia, to producers who experienced a shortage of winter feed for eligible livestock, as defined in section 6, as a result of the negative effect excess moisture had on 2011 forage production. The text consists of 26 sections divided into 5 Parts.
